# the libraries for which check bloat difference is calculated
LIBS = [
'libgrpc.so',
'libgrpc++.so',
]
def _build(output_dir):
"""Perform the cmake build under the output_dir."""
shutil.rmtree(output_dir, ignore_errors=True)
subprocess.check_call('mkdir -p %s' % output_dir, shell=True, cwd='.')
subprocess.check_call([
'cmake', '-DgRPC_BUILD_TESTS=OFF', '-DBUILD_SHARED_LIBS=ON',
'-DCMAKE_BUILD_TYPE=RelWithDebInfo', '-DCMAKE_C_FLAGS="-gsplit-dwarf"',
'-DCMAKE_CXX_FLAGS="-gsplit-dwarf"', '..'
],
cwd=output_dir)
subprocess.check_call('make -j%d' % args.jobs, shell=True, cwd=output_dir)
def _rank_diff_bytes(diff_bytes):
"""Determine how significant diff_bytes is, and return a simple integer representing that"""
mul = 1
if diff_bytes < 0:
mul = -1
diff_bytes = -diff_bytes
if diff_bytes < 2 * 1024:
return 0
if diff_bytes < 16 * 1024:
return 1 * mul
if diff_bytes < 128 * 1024:
return 2 * mul
return 3 * mul
